Deck 50: Overview of the Female and Male Reproductive Systems
1
In the woman,which of the following hormones promotes the formation of progesterone?

A) Follicle-stimulating hormone
B) Luteinizing hormone
C) Adrenal corticotropic hormone
D) Antidiuretic hormone
Luteinizing hormone
2
Which of the following hormones initiates the cycle of events in the female ovary?

A) Follicle-stimulating hormone
B) Luteinizing hormone
C) Adrenal corticotropic hormone
D) Antidiuretic hormone
Follicle-stimulating hormone
3
In the female menstrual cycle,at which of the following days does ovulation commonly occur?

A) Day 3
B) Day 7
C) Day 14
D) Day 21
Day 14
